![]() |
Re: ListView: Erste Spalte rechtsbündig
Zitat:
|
Re: ListView: Erste Spalte rechtsbündig
Bisher noch leer, ich dachte die Eigenschaft auf True setzen reicht aus. Allerdings lese ich mir gerade deine verlinkte Seite durch, wie das mit dem OwnerDraw genau funktioniert. Ist denn OnCustomDraw nicht eigentlich das gleiche?
|
Re: ListView: Erste Spalte rechtsbündig
Damit sagst Du nur das Du selber zeichnen möchtest. Dafür muss dann aber auch etwas in OnOwnerDraw stehen.
|
Re: ListView: Erste Spalte rechtsbündig
Das wird mir dann für so eine kleine optische Sache doch zu umständlich. Ich dachte, ich könnte einfach mit OnCustomDrawSubItem den Text rechtsbündig gestalten, keine Chance. Selbst auf den Delphi-Seiten von about.com oder auch
![]() |
Re: ListView: Erste Spalte rechtsbündig
Ich habe gerade dasselbe Problem und habe dazu folgendes gefunden:
![]() Das kann doch nicht sein?! Da muss es doch eine Lösung für geben, die Spalte rechtsbündig hinzubekommen? Was macht man zum Beispiel in Sprachen, die generell rechtsbündig geschrieben werden? |
Re: ListView: Erste Spalte rechtsbündig
Probier mal dies hier:
Delphi-Quellcode:
Das müsste funktionierten.
column:=ListView1.Columns.Add;
column.Alignment := taRightJustify; |
Re: ListView: Erste Spalte rechtsbündig
Zitat:
|
Re: ListView: Erste Spalte rechtsbündig
Vielleicht ist das in #7 nicht ganz klar formuliert gewesen:
Zitat:
|
Re: ListView: Erste Spalte rechtsbündig
Zitat:
|
Re: ListView: Erste Spalte rechtsbündig
Dann müsstest Du ja das entsprechende VCL-Package neu kompilieren.
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 14:34 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z